titleOfInvention |
Microwave-excited elecrodeles discharge bulb and microwave-excited discharge lamp system |
abstract |
An improved microwave-excited electrodeless discharge bulb and a lamp system using the bulb are designed to produce a nearly white light at an increased luminous efficacy. The bulb encloses a filling containing a mixture of a rare earth halide, a sodium halide, mercury, and a rare gas. The rare earth halide is at least one selected from a group consisting of a cerium halide and praseodymium halide. With the inclusion of cerium halide and/or praseodymium halide in combination with the mercury, the bulb can produce nearly white light at superior luminous efficacy, when energized by the microwave. |
